Abstract
The invention relates to a connecting device for fixing a pull-out guide ( 5 ) to a side grate ( 1 ), in particular for baking ovens, comprising a holder ( 10 ), which has at least one hook ( 11 ) for engaging with a horizontal brace ( 3 ) of the side grate ( 1 ), and a spring element ( 12, 12″, 12″′, 12″″ ), by means of which the holder ( 10 ) can be latched to the side grate ( 1 ), wherein the spring element ( 12, 12′, 12″′, 12″″ ) is designed as a separate component and has a flexible spring leg ( 15 ) for latching the holder ( 10 ).

A connecting device for fixing a pull-out guide ( 5 ) to a side grate ( 1 ), especially for baking ovens, comprising a holder ( 10 ) which has at least one hook ( 11 ) for engaging in a horizontal brace ( 3 ) of the side grate ( 1 ) and a spring element ( 12 , 12 ″, 12 ″′, 12 ″″) by means of which the holder ( 10 ) can be latched onto the side grate ( 1 ), characterized in that the spring element ( 12 , 12 ″, 12 ″′, 12 ″″) is arranged as a separate component and comprises a flexible spring leg ( 15 ) for latching the holder ( 10 ).
2 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the spring element ( 12 , 12 ″, 12 ″′, 12 ″″) is fixed on the holder ( 10 ) in the latched position.
3 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the holder ( 10 ) is arranged as an angle which forms the hook ( 11 ) on one side and a support for the pull-out guide ( 5 ) on a bent-off section ( 30 ).
4 . A connecting device according to claim 3 , characterized in that a recess ( 32 ) is arranged on the bent-off section ( 30 ), into which a vertical pillar ( 2 ) of the side grate ( 1 ) can be inserted.
5 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the spring element ( 12 , 12 ″, 12 ″′) is arranged as a leaf spring.
6 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the flexible spring leg ( 15 ) has a length of at least 2 cm.
7 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the spring element ( 12 , 12 ″, 12 ″′) is provided with a substantially L-shaped arrangement, with one leg forming the spring leg ( 15 ) and the other leg ( 16 ) resting on the bent-off section ( 30 ) of the holder ( 10 ).
8 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that a second holder ( 20 ) is provided which comprises a hook ( 21 ) for engagement in a horizontal brace ( 3 ) of the side grate ( 1 ).
9 . A connecting device according to claim 8 , characterized in that the second holder ( 20 ) comprises a strip-like section on which a groove ( 23 ) is formed for inserting a vertical pillar ( 2 ) of the side grate ( 1 ).
10 . A connecting device according to claim 8 , characterized in that a horizontal extension arm ( 26 ) is provided on the second holder ( 20 ), on which a rail ( 6 ) of the pull-out guide ( 5 ) is fixed.
11 . A connecting device according to claim 10 , characterized in that the extension arm ( 26 ) can be inserted into the rail ( 6 ).
12 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the spring element ( 12 ″, 12 ″′) comprises a spring leg ( 17 ″, 17 ″′) which is wound in itself, especially in a spiral manner.
13 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the spring element ( 12 ″, 12 ″′, 12 ″″) comprises a spiral-shaped blank made from a flatbed spring.
14 . A connecting device according to claim 1 , characterized in that the first holder ( 10 ), the second holder ( 20 ) and/or the spring element ( 12 , 12 ″, 12 ″′, 12 ″″) is made of a sheet metal.
